jonnin

Its like any other such thing, moderation is the key.   Learning to budget some time each day or once a week for the game, and to control yourself yet still have your hobby, is a personal growth that will serve you well for a lifetime.   Giving up your hobby, if you love the game, may work for the specific issue but the next thing you like to do may also become a problem, because you did not learn self control the first time around.
